How to Calculate Body Fat Percentage Correctly

Understanding your body composition is critical for anyone serious about fitness, weight loss, or general health. While Body Mass Index (BMI) is a common metric, it often fails to distinguish between muscle mass and fat mass. This is where a dedicated Body Fat Calculator becomes an essential tool. By using specific body measurements—height, neck, waist, and hips (for women)—you can get a much more accurate picture of your "leanness."

Our tool uses the U.S. Navy Method, which has been studied extensively and found to be remarkably accurate for most people (typically within 3-4% of specialized scans like DEXA). Whether you are looking to lose weight or build muscle, knowing your starting percentage allows you to set realistic goals and track progress that the scale might miss.

Using the US Navy Method for Body Fat Analysis

The US Navy method body fat formula is a widely accepted technique developed by the Naval Health Research Center. It relies on the relationship between circumference measurements and total body volume. Because muscle is denser than fat, people with more muscle tend to have smaller circumferences relative to their height.

The formula calculates the "circularity" of your body. For men, the primary focus is on the waist-to-neck ratio. For women, the hips are also included because women naturally carry more essential fat in the lower body for reproductive health. Understanding the Body Fat Percentage Chart

Once you have your result, it's important to know where you stand. Health organizations typically categorize body fat into several ranges. Here is a standard body fat percentage chart for reference:

Category Women (%) Men (%)
Essential Fat 10–13% 2–5%
Athletes 14–20% 6–13%
Fitness 21–24% 14–17%
Average 25–31% 18–24%
Obese 32%+ 25%+

Aiming for a "Fitness" or "Athlete" range is common for active individuals, but reaching an ideal body fat percentage depends on your personal health goals and lifestyle.

Step-by-Step Guide: How to Measure Body Fat at Home

For the most accurate results with our calculator, you need to know how to measure body fat using a flexible measuring tape. Follow these specific protocols:

  • Neck: Measure just below the larynx, keeping the tape horizontal and shoulders relaxed.
  • Waist: For men, measure at the navel. For women, measure at the narrowest part of the torso.
  • Hips (Women only): Measure at the widest part of the buttocks/hips.
  • Height: Stand straight against a wall without shoes.

Consistency is key. Measure at the same time of day (preferably in the morning before eating) to avoid variations caused by bloating or hydration levels.

The Benefits of Tracking Body Composition

Metabolic Clarity

Fat mass and muscle mass burn calories at different rates. Knowing your body fat helps you calculate your true Basal Metabolic Rate (BMR).

Disease Prevention

High visceral fat (the fat around organs) is a major risk factor for heart disease and type 2 diabetes.

Muscle Retention

When dieting, a body fat calculator helps ensure you are losing fat, not valuable muscle tissue.

Targeted Nutrition

Adjust your protein and carbohydrate intake based on your current leanness and future physique goals.

Accuracy and Limitations of Online Calculators

While the Navy Method is statistically strong, it is an estimation. Factors like bone density, extreme muscle mass (bodybuilders), or localized water retention can sway the results. For clinical precision, DEXA scans or hydrostatic weighing are the gold standards.
